1. A cosmetic composition comprising cholesteric liquid crystal particles having an average particle diameter of 50 to 500 μm.

2. The cosmetic composition according to claim 1, wherein the cholesteric liquid crystal particles are present in the form of a dispersed phase or a continuous phase of an oil-in-water emulsion or a water-in-oil emulsion.

3. The cosmetic composition according to claim 1, wherein the dispersion degree (α) of the cholesteric liquid crystal particles is 0.35 or less.

4. The cosmetic composition according to claim 1, wherein the cholesteric liquid crystal particles are contained in an amount of 0.1 to 10% by weight, relative to the total weight of the composition.

5. The cosmetic composition according to claim 2, wherein the emulsion is an oil-in-water emulsion, and the aqueous phase portion of the oil-in-water emulsion comprises 10 to 50% by weight of the moisturizing agent, 0.01 to 1.0% by weight of the thickening agent, and the balance purified water, relative to the total weight of the composition.

6. The cosmetic composition according to claim 5, wherein the humectant is one or more selected from the group consisting of glycerin, butylene glycol, propylene glycol, dipropylene glycol, diglycerin, pentanediol, isoprene glycol, and erythritol.

7. The cosmetic composition according to claim 5, wherein the thickener is one or more selected from the group consisting of guar gum, xanthan gum, ethyl cellulose, hydroxyethyl cellulose, carboxymethyl cellulose, sodium polyacrylate, glycerol polyacrylate, and hydroxypropyl cellulose.

8. A method for producing a cosmetic composition, which comprises

A step of preparing a liquid crystal portion containing cholesteric liquid crystal; and

and a step of dispersing the liquid crystal portion into a continuous phase after passing through a porous film, and converting the liquid crystal portion into a liquid crystal particle dispersed phase to obtain an emulsion containing cholesteric liquid crystal particles.

9. The method for producing a cosmetic composition according to claim 8, further comprising the step of cooling the emulsion.

10. The method for producing a cosmetic composition according to claim 8, wherein the porous film is porous alumina, porous zirconia, porous stainless steel or porous glass.

11. The method for producing a cosmetic composition according to claim 8, wherein the average diameter of the pores of the porous membrane is 0.1 μm to 2 mm.

Technical Field

The present invention relates to a cosmetic composition containing cholesteric liquid crystal particles and a method for producing the same, and more particularly, to a cosmetic composition which improves the viewing angle dependence of the unique appearance characteristics of cholesteric liquid crystal particles, i.e., the color changing with the viewing angle, by adjusting the size and particle size distribution of cholesteric liquid crystal particles, and a method for producing the same.

Background

Cholesteric liquid crystals are liquid crystals in which each layer of molecules arranged in a planar shape is spirally rotated, and are used in temperature sensors, display devices, and the like by utilizing their unique optical characteristics. Recently, a cosmetic material that utilizes visual dependency of a cholesteric liquid crystal, which is one of characteristics of the cholesteric liquid crystal, and changes in color tone depending on a viewing angle has been attracting attention.

For example, JP2015-063477a discloses an emulsified cosmetic composition containing cholesteric liquid crystal particles obtained by pulverizing a light reflecting layer formed by fixing at least one of a dextrorotatory cholesteric liquid crystal phase and a levorotatory cholesteric liquid crystal phase, and an alcohol having an alkyl group of 2 to 5 carbon atoms, and an oil agent and an emulsifier, and JP2010-90206A discloses a liquid crystal composition having a cholesteric phase at room temperature or around body temperature by using a plant material and exhibiting an aesthetic decorative effect when applied to human lips or skin, and a cosmetic composition containing the same.

However, when cholesteric liquid crystal is used in a dosage form by the conventional method disclosed in the above patent, there are problems in that it is difficult to manufacture a certain form of appearance, and aesthetic characteristics of appearance may be lost due to stability problems such as structural destruction of cholesteric liquid crystal during the manufacturing process.

Disclosure of Invention

Technical subject

Accordingly, the present inventors have made an effort to include cholesteric liquid crystals in a liquid phase formulation in a certain form, and as a result, have confirmed that when cholesteric liquid crystal particles having a uniform particle size distribution are dispersed in an aqueous phase part while adjusting the particle size by a film emulsification method to manufacture an emulsion, the stability of the particles can be secured, and in addition, the unique appearance of the cholesteric liquid crystal particles, i.e., the characteristic that the color changes depending on the viewing angle, can be improved, thereby completing the present invention.

Means for solving the problems

An object of the present invention is to provide a cosmetic composition which improves the expression of the unique appearance characteristic of cholesteric liquid crystal particles, i.e., the viewing angle dependence of color as a function of viewing angle.

Another object of the present invention is to provide a method for manufacturing a cosmetic composition comprising the above cholesteric liquid crystal particles.

Effects of the invention

According to the cosmetic composition containing cholesteric liquid crystal particles of the present invention, since cholesteric liquid crystal particles having an average particle diameter of particles adjusted to a range of 50 μm to 500 μm and having a narrow particle size distribution are contained, visual dependence of color or hue depending on viewing angle is greatly improved.

Detailed Description

The cosmetic composition of the present invention for achieving the above object comprises cholesteric liquid crystal particles having an average particle diameter of 50 to 500 μm.

The cholesteric liquid crystal particles may be present in the form of a dispersed phase of an oil-in-water emulsion or a water-in-oil emulsion.

The value of the degree of dispersion (α) of the cholesteric liquid crystal particles may be 0.35 or less.

The content of the cholesteric liquid crystal particles may be 0.1 to 10% by weight.

The emulsion is an oil-in-water type emulsion, and the water phase portion of the oil-in-water type emulsion may contain 10 to 50% by weight of a humectant, 0.01 to 1.0% by weight of a thickener, and purified water.

The method for producing the cosmetic composition according to the present invention comprises: preparing liquid crystal portions containing cholesteric liquid crystals, respectively; and a step of dispersing the liquid crystal portion into a continuous phase after passing through the porous film, and converting the liquid crystal portion into a liquid crystal particle dispersed phase to obtain an emulsion.

The above manufacturing method may further comprise the step of cooling the emulsion.

The porous film may be porous alumina, porous zirconia, porous stainless steel or porous glass.

The average diameter of the pores of the porous membrane may be 0.1 μm to 2 mm.
